Cheesy Jalapeño Popper Bites

Cheesy Jalapeño Popper Bites are savory finger foods featuring phyllo dough shells filled with a creamy blend of cream cheese, sharp cheddar, mayonnaise, and both fresh and pickled jalapeños. The filling is seasoned with garlic powder and salt, with optional added heat from red pepper flakes or cayenne. Topped with crumbled bacon (or vegetarian bacon bits), these bites deliver a rich, spicy, and crispy appetizer choice for parties or gatherings.

Prep Time
25 mins
Cook Time
10 mins
Total Time
35 mins
Servings: 30 phyllo bites
Calories: 50 kcal
Course: Appetizer
Cuisine: American

Ingredients

  • 30 phyllo dough shells two 15-count packages, frozen
  • 4 oz cream cheese
  • 2 TBSP mayonnaise
  • 1 cup cheddar cheese grated sharp
  • 1 jalapeno pepper
  • 3 TBSP jalapeño diced, jarred
  • ⅛ tsp garlic powder
  • ⅛ tsp salt
  • 2-3 TBSP Bacon or veggie bacon bits, crumbled cooked

Instructions

    Cup of Yum
  1. NOTE: For the jalapeños I like to use both diced jarred jalapeños (they have a pickled nacho-topping vibe to them that's oh so flavorful) and fresh minced jalapeños. You can absolutely use all of one or the other but I find that I adore poppers with both the most.
  2. Preheat oven to 375°F.
  3. Arrange phyllo shells on a baking sheet and set aside.
  4. Soften cream cheese to room temperature or lightly warm for 15-20 seconds in the microwave. Combine with grated cheddar cheese and mayo. Mix well.
  5. Remove stem and seeds from jalapeno (or keep the seeds if you want them spicy) and finely mince.
  6. Add fresh minced jalapeño along with pickled jarred jalapeño to your cheese mixture. Season with garlic powder and a pinch of salt and mix well. For extra heat you can add optional crushed red pepper flakes or cayenne pepper.
  7. Spoon mixture into phyllo shells and top with crumbled bacon (or veggie bacon bits if vegetarian) - the bacon can also be skipped and they'll still be super tasty!
  8. Bake at 375°F for 10-15 minutes until the phyllo is nice and crispy and the cheesy filling is hot and melty. Enjoy!

Notes

  • Using both fresh minced and pickled jalapeños combines fresh heat with pickled tang for a more complex popper flavor.
  • Crumbled bacon can be omitted or substituted with vegetarian bacon bits for a meatless version that remains flavorful.
  • Adjust the heat level by retaining or removing jalapeño seeds and adding optional crushed red pepper flakes or cayenne pepper.
  • Bake the filled phyllo shells promptly after assembling to maintain crispness and prevent sogginess.
